深度解读Yoast SEO插件:PHP, Java和C++的完美融合
在网站优化领域,Yoast SEO插件是一个无法或缺的工具,它协助网站管理员更深入地了解并优化他们的网站,以提升搜索引擎排名,Yoast SEO插件是如何利用PHP、Java和C++等编程语言实现这些功能呢?本文将对此进行深度探讨。
我们需要了解Yoast SEO插件的基本功能,这款插件可以帮助用户检查和优化网站的元数据,包括标题、描述和关键词等,它还提供了一个内容分析功能,能够评估文章的内容质量和可读性,所有这些功能都是通过PHP编写的。
PHP是一种广泛使用的服务器端脚本语言,特别适合于Web开发,Yoast SEO插件的主要功能都是通过PHP实现的,当用户在网站上输入标题、描述或关键词时,这些信息会被发送到服务器,然后由PHP处理并存储在数据库中,同样,当用户使用内容分析功能时,WordPress会调用Yoast SEO插件的API,然后由PHP处理并返回结果。
PHP并不是Yoast SEO插件的全部,这个插件还使用了Java(JavaScript API for Web)来增强其功能,Java是一个JavaScript库,提供了一种简单的方式来访问和使用网页上的各种元素,当用户在Yoast SEO插件的设置页面上更改一个选项时,这个更改会被Java捕获并传递给PHP进行处理。
C++也是Yoast SEO插件的一个重要组成部分,虽然C++主要用于后端开发,但它也可以用于前端开发,Yoast SEO插件的一些性能敏感的功能,如元数据处理和内容分析,就是用C++编写的,这是因为C++的性能比PHP和Java都要高,可以提供更快的响应时间。
Yoast SEO插件是一个复杂的软件系统,它结合了PHP、Java和C++等多种编程语言的优点,PHP提供了强大的Web开发能力,Java增强了插件的交互性,而C++则提高了插件的性能,这种多语言的结合使得Yoast SEO插件成为了一个强大而灵活的工具,可以帮助网站管理员更好地优化他们的网站。
这并不意味着任何人都可以轻易地理解和修改Yoast SEO插件,这个插件的代码是开源的,但理解和修改它需要深厚的编程知识和经验,如果你是一个PHP、Java和C++的专家,那么你可能会发现这是一个有趣的挑战,否则,你可能需要寻求专业的帮助。
无论你是哪种情况,都不要忘记,Yoast SEO插件只是一个工具,真正重要的是你的网站内容,只有高质量的内容,才能吸引和保持用户的注意力,从而提高你的搜索引擎排名。
还没有评论,来说两句吧...